Не могу сериализовать объект с полем Security


Не могу сериализовать объект с полем Security
Atom
6/29/2013


Есть необходимость сериализовать объект, у которого одно из полей - Dictionary <Security, decimal>.
При компиляции Visual Studio ругается на отсутствие атрибута Serialize у класса Transaq Manager. Есть ли какая-либо возможность выйти из ситуации?

Tags:


Thanks:


VassilSanych

Avatar
Date: 6/30/2013
Reply


Lipot Go to
Есть необходимость сериализовать объект, у которого одно из полей - Dictionary <Security, decimal>.
При компиляции Visual Studio ругается на отсутствие атрибута Serialize у класса Transaq Manager. Есть ли какая-либо возможность выйти из ситуации?

Ага.
- не сериализовать объект
- сделать другой объект (не могу придумать, зачем роботу сериализовать словари, которые обычным образом тоже не сериализуются)
- сделать ключом не тяжёлый для сериализации объект Security, а его идентификатор. Сделать сериализуемый словарь. Удивляться почему всё тормозит.

Очевидно непонимание принципов сериализации. Если вы чего-то не понимаете, не делайте этого.

Thanks:

Lipot

Avatar
Date: 6/30/2013
Reply


Выбрал 3 вариант.
Thanks:


Attach files by dragging & dropping, , or pasting from the clipboard.

loading
clippy